| pressure: | Atmospheric to 0.5 MPa during curing, negligible post-cure |
| other spec: | Viscosity: 500-2000 cP at 25°C (mix-dependent), Pot life: 30-90 minutes, Cure time: 2-8 hours at elevated temperature |
| temperature: | -40°C to +155°C continuous, up to +180°C short-term |

This electrical grade epoxy resin compound has a CTI rating of V, indicating excellent resistance to surface tracking and electrical breakdown in high-voltage applications.
The thermal conductivity (measured in W/m·K) ensures efficient heat dissipation from encapsulated components, preventing overheating and maintaining dielectric properties in distribution and control apparatus.
The pot life is specified in minutes, providing adequate working time for mixing, dispensing, and encapsulating electrical components before the thermosetting reaction completes.
